Abstract

A safety valve which has two fluidically interconnected safety valves, each of which has a 4/2-way valve function. Each safety valve has a first connecting port and a second connecting port, which are connected to each other in such a way that a fluid flow through the two safety valves, controlled by means of a control valve, to a fluid-actuated drive is prevented if the two safety valves simultaneously adopt a first switching position and such a fluid flow is possible if both valves simultaneously have a second switching state. One safety aspect results from the fact that the above-mentioned fluid flow is also prevented if the two safety valves adopt different switching states.
